Hello, I currently have a four default routes on a 2621 router that is doing load balancing to four adsl modems/routers (which are doing NAT).
ip cef 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 192.168.11.251 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 192.168.11.252 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 192.168.11.253 ip route 0.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 192.168.11.254 This is working for load balancing, but when one of the modems stops working I basically loose all connection to the internet. What would be the best way to verify the availability of the next hop?
